‘The Slot Squad’ streamers launch incredible charity initiative on Twitch aiming to raise $1 Million

The Twitch channel dedicated to streaming online slots and casino games are embarking on a mission to raise $1 Million in a series of virtual charity fundraisers.

Something amazing is happening over at twitch.tv/theslotsquad this month as Wedge Traffic’s new online slots and casino channel looks to give something back to the community in a series of virtual charity fundraisers.

Launched on January 1st 2021, The Slot Squad is a brand new online slots and casino Twitch channel which showcases all of the new games that are now available in various states across the US.

Viewers of the channel get the chance to see the newest slot games in action, chat to likeminded casino fans, enter free giveaway competitions, claim free bets for the online casinos and witness huge real money wins from the streamers.

The new channel targets audiences in states where online casino gaming is permitted – New Jersey, Pennsylvania, West Virginia and, most recently, Michigan. However, the channel welcomes casino fans from other US states and beyond every night.

Enthusiastic and animated Twitch personalities Anthony ‘EatAHoagie’ Cicali III and Vinny Goombatz are the faces of the channel and have built a nightly audience from their base in New Jersey that extends into the thousands. They now have charity firmly in their sights and aim to raise as much money as possible for local state charities.
